The GMC Terrain 2021 model year comes equipped with a sophisticated electrical system that ensures the optimal functioning of various on-board components. The fuse box, specifically model number 663.GM9.H21, plays a pivotal role in safeguarding this system by protecting against overcurrents and short circuits.
Located in the engine compartment, this fuse box is a compact, yet robust, component designed to withstand the rigors of the road. Measuring approximately 7.5 inches long, 4.2 inches wide, and 1.7 inches high, it houses several automotive-grade fuses that cater to different electrical systems. These systems include, but are not limited to, the engine and transmission, lighting, power accessories, and the infotainment and communication modules.
Each fuse is meticulously designed to melt at a specific current, thereby preventing damage to the vehicle's electrical systems and ensuring passenger safety. The fuse box itself is constructed from high-impact, flame-retardant materials to protect against potential heat and fire hazards.
The 663.GM9.H21 fuse box for the 2021 GMC Terrain features a user-friendly design, with easy-to-remove covers and a logical layout of the fuse positions. This allows for quick and efficient fuse replacement when necessary. Additionally, the fuse box includes a conveniently located accessory power distribution center, enabling the installation of aftermarket accessories such as stereo systems or power inverters.
In summary, the 663.GM9.H21 fuse box is an essential component of the 2021 GMC Terrain's electrical system. Its robust construction, logical layout, and ability to protect against potential electrical hazards make it a dependable and indispensable part of your vehicle.
Buying a GMC Terrain 2021 cabin fuse box (part number: 663.Gm9h21) can be a significant investment for vehicle owners looking to address electrical issues or prevent potential problems in their vehicle. Here are some potential pros and cons to consider before making a purchase:
Pros:1. Diagnosis and repair: A new fuse box can help you diagnose and repair various electrical issues in your GMC Terrain. It ensures that all the circuits are functioning properly, reducing the risk of electrical failures.
2. Peace of mind: Replacing a faulty fuse box with a new one can provide peace of mind, knowing that your electrical system is in good working order. This can be especially important if you frequently travel long distances or rely heavily on your vehicle's electrical features.
3. Cost-effective: Replacing a faulty fuse box is often a more cost-effective solution compared to repairing individual circuits or components.
4. OEM quality: A genuine O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) fuse box, like the 663.Gm9h21, ensures that all electrical connections are made with the correct materials and specifications, ensuring optimal performance and reliability.
Cons:1. Cost: Replacing a fuse box can be an expensive repair, especially when considering labor costs if you choose to have it installed by a professional.
2. Time-consuming: Installing a new fuse box can be a time-consuming process, especially if you choose to do it yourself. Be prepared for a few hours of work, depending on your mechanical skills and the complexity of the installation.
3. Availability: It may take some time to source and receive the fuse box if it is not readily available in local auto parts stores or through your dealership.
4. Potential for unintended consequences: Replacing a fuse box can potentially cause unintended consequences, such as disabling certain features or causing other electrical issues if not installed correctly.
